18 references to Element
System.Private.Xml (18)
System\Xml\Xsl\IlGen\XmlIlVisitor.cs (7)
1931
kinds = XmlNodeKindFlags.
Element
;
2426
kinds = XmlNodeKindFlags.
Element
;
3253
if ((object)typItem == (object)TypeFactory.Element) kinds |= XmlNodeKindFlags.
Element
;
3277
case XmlNodeKindFlags.
Element
: kindsRuntime = XPathNodeType.Element; break;
3304
if ((kinds & XmlNodeKindFlags.
Element
) != 0) kindsUnion |= (1 << (int)XPathNodeType.Element);
4578
case XmlNodeKindFlags.
Element
: return XPathNodeType.Element;
4616
Debug.Assert(xmlTypes == XmlNodeKindFlags.
Element
);
System\Xml\Xsl\XmlNodeKindFlags.cs (1)
59
Content =
Element
| Comment | PI | Text,
System\Xml\Xsl\XmlQueryType.cs (1)
531
if (this.TypeCode == other.TypeCode && (this.NodeKinds & (XmlNodeKindFlags.Document | XmlNodeKindFlags.
Element
| XmlNodeKindFlags.Attribute)) != 0)
System\Xml\Xsl\XmlQueryTypeFactory.cs (1)
520
XmlTypeCode.Element => XmlNodeKindFlags.
Element
,
System\Xml\Xsl\XPath\XPathBuilder.cs (3)
379
/*Element */ XmlNodeKindFlags.
Element
,
730
/*Ancestor */ XmlNodeKindFlags.
Element
| XmlNodeKindFlags.Document,
739
/*Parent */ XmlNodeKindFlags.
Element
| XmlNodeKindFlags.Document,
System\Xml\Xsl\Xslt\MatcherBuilder.cs (2)
137
_nodeKind == XmlNodeKindFlags.
Element
|| _nodeKind == XmlNodeKindFlags.Attribute || _nodeKind == XmlNodeKindFlags.PI,
344
case XmlNodeKindFlags.
Element
: _elementPatterns.Add(pattern); break;
System\Xml\Xsl\Xslt\QilGenerator.cs (3)
1304
if (node.XmlType.NodeKinds == XmlNodeKindFlags.
Element
)
1322
else if ((node.XmlType.NodeKinds & (XmlNodeKindFlags.
Element
| XmlNodeKindFlags.Document)) == XmlNodeKindFlags.None)
1866
case XmlNodeKindFlags.
Element
: result = _f.IsType(testNode, T.Element); break;